Freelancing, or working as a contractor for an individual or a company, can be a difficult, but very rewarding job that has been growing in popularity in recent years. The advent of the internet has allowed freelancers to take their work home, no longer forcing the freelancer to ever work at the company office. This is a tremedous benefit for both the company and the worker, as working from home is one of the most wanted aspects of any position.

But what kinds of projects are available for telecommuting positions, and what tools and skills does one require in order to become a great telecommuting employee?

Telecommuters can do almost any job that necessitates a PC. These positions include almost anything from creating content for websites to doing graphics design jobs to creating scripts, to overseeing the merging of multiple systems. If a personal computer is necessary for the contract, it can surely be completed outside of the office, and there is probably going to be a telecommuter who specializes in that style of project.

Since the individuals who accept freelancers are almost always directors, they often lack the technical understanding to be able to help a software designer with detailed instructions on code. Thus, freelancers are required to be very knowledgeable, and know how to obtain the answers to problems that may arise.

Additionally, freelancers are required to have the necessary software in-house, or have them given by their employer. Very often, software such as word processors for writers and programmers are available on the net, however there are a few projects which often need expensive photo imaging programs or expensive compilers which are specifically used by a given company. If they require you to work with a specific version of software, it potentially be up to you, as a telecommuter, to buy the tool on your own though this is typically rare.

While it may not seem like a good job, telecommuting is a wonderful career for individuals with writing, programming, and organizing skills. Winning bids on projects may appear unpleasant to you, you should find that your abilities and skills are in demand after you get positive commentary on your work. That should allow you to charge greater fees for your work and make even more money.

When first getting started as a telecommuter, it is best to bid on assignments that you know you can do very well. This way you can ensure that you will not find many problems during the course of the contract, and that will lead to great comments on your profile, and higher paying projects, the next time.
